The common mushroom, the most used at the culinary level, has a mild, neutral and delicate flavor, with a slight nutty smell, low caloric yield, widely used in salads and sauces. It is slightly rich in fiber, and with content of vitamin B6, vitamin D and vitamin C, also niacin and potassium.
